Cost of the Road Test
The road test is your final step towards getting a motorcycle license. The preparation for the test ahead of time is crucial. You'll save time and money by getting ready ahead of time. You can read the MV-21MC New York State Motorcycle Operator's Manual on the DMV website and take tests to become familiar with the information. Also, you should have a valid driver's license or learner permit, and proof of identity. You will need to provide documents like birth certificate, passport, utility bill or rental contract. You'll be required to provide your Social Security number.
In addition to studying the manual, you should also practice riding your bike with a licensed instructor. You should practice exercises like slow driving and figure eights, turning (both right and left) U-turns, avoiding and going over dangers on the road and turning around in parking lots. You should also take a ride in light, medium or heavy traffic at night and during the day.
When you are ready for your road test, make an appointment online on the DMV website. The system will locate the earliest test time available at locations near your ZIP code. The most common test dates are 3 to 5 weeks away. However, during peak periods such as summer and school holidays it is possible to wait for up to 10 weeks.
When you have completed the road test, you'll need to pay a fee. This fee is determined by your age and where you live. In New York, the fee for a class M motorcycle license starts at $85 for 16-year-olds and increases with age. You'll also need to pay an Metropolitan Commuter Transportation District fee of $1 for every six-month period that your permit or license is valid.
If you wish to upgrade to an Enhanced Motorcycle License, you will be required to pay an additional fee of $30. This is a vital step to consider if you are planning to travel internationally. To be able to travel to certain countries, you'll require an Enhanced License. The payment must be made at the same as you submit your application.
